What is a Personal Injury Attorney?
An accident attorney focuses on offering legal representation to people who have sustained physical or mental injuries due to the carelessness or wrongdoing of another party. These lawyers are well-versed in tort law, which incorporates all civil lawsuits for injuries and damages.
Take advantage of their competence can significantly impact the outcome of your case, assisting you protect the compensation you should have for medical costs, lost incomes, and discomfort and suffering.

While some people may think about managing their injury claims without legal representation, there are a number of engaging factors why hiring an experienced injury attorney is vital. Here are a couple of:
Expertise in the Legal System: Personal injury law is complex. An experienced attorney comprehends the subtleties and can browse the legal system efficiently.
Maximizing Compensation: Insurance companies are understood for providing settlements that are often lower than what victims deserve. An attorney can negotiate on behalf of their customers to guarantee they get fair compensation.
Proof Gathering: A skilled injury attorney knows how to gather and present evidence efficiently. This can consist of witness declarations, medical records, and expert statements.
Minimizing Stress: Dealing with injuries is challenging enough. An attorney can take on the legal problem, permitting customers to concentrate on recovery.
Contingency Fees: Most accident lawyers deal with a contingency charge basis, meaning they just make money if their customer receives compensation. This structure makes legal representation accessible to those who might not have the funds for in advance legal charges.

Understanding the steps associated with a personal injury claim can assist customers feel more prepared. Here's a basic summary of the process:
Initial Consultation: The customer meets the attorney to go over the case, evaluate its benefits, and figure out the very best strategy.
Investigation: The attorney will conduct a comprehensive examination, gathering proof, speaking with witnesses, and consulting professionals if essential.
Submitting a Claim: The attorney will file a claim with the appropriate insurance business, detailing the injury and requesting compensation.
Negotiation: If the initial offer is insufficient, the attorney will work out with the insurance adjuster to protect a fair settlement.
Litigation: If negotiations stop working, the case may go to trial. The attorney will prepare the case for court, providing proof and arguing on behalf of the client.
Settlement or Verdict: The case concludes either through a worked out settlement or a court judgment.

When should I hire an accident attorney?
It is recommended to seek advice from an injury attorney as soon as possible after an accident. Early legal advice can enhance the outcome of your claim.
2. How much does it cost to work with an injury attorney?
Most personal injury attorneys deal with a contingency fee basis, meaning you owe them absolutely nothing unless they win your case.
3. For how long do I have to submit an injury claim?
The statute of restrictions varies by state however usually ranges from one to 6 years. It's vital to inspect the particular laws in your jurisdiction.
4. What if my injury is partly my fault?
In numerous states, you can still recuperate damages if you share some fault for the accident. However, the compensation may be minimized by your portion of liability.
5. What types of damages can I claim?
Damages can include medical expenditures, lost wages, discomfort and suffering, and sometimes punitive damages for gross negligence.
